Transaction 6411aef5d86685890d30293095670c172e6bb4159ed1120ab6bfcdcfd0527d58

1 Input
2 Outputs
  • 6411aef5d86685890d30293095670c172e6bb4159ed1120ab6bfcdcfd0527d58:0
  • value  20000000
    address  34fzZ5bV1Tu2kTEWEbfSGqxH3TArxt7H2H
  • 6411aef5d86685890d30293095670c172e6bb4159ed1120ab6bfcdcfd0527d58:1
  • value  207039
    address  3LfDVWdmZHRUrWDKHot4obxJGUJTBWoKb3